随着技术的不断进步,HTML5作为一种强大的网页开发技术,正在逐渐渗透到各个领域,包括笔记本操作系统。大神28官网在线预测为我们提供了一个独特的视角,探讨HTML5在笔记本操作系统中的应用及其未来发展。本文将围绕这一主题,提出可能的问题,并深入探讨这些问题,以期为读者提供有价值、信息丰富的内容。

1. HTML5在笔记本操作系统中的应用现状如何?

HTML5作为一种跨平台的网页开发技术,已经在移动设备和桌面浏览器中得到了广泛应用。然而,其在笔记本操作系统中的应用现状如何?是否已经实现了无缝集成?

现状分析

目前,许多笔记本操作系统已经开始支持HTML5应用。例如,Windows 10的Microsoft Edge浏览器已经全面支持HTML5标准,用户可以通过浏览器直接运行基于HTML5的应用程序。此外,Linux发行版如Ubuntu也通过其默认浏览器Firefox支持HTML5应用。

然而,尽管HTML5在浏览器中的应用已经相当成熟,但在笔记本操作系统中的集成仍然面临一些挑战。例如,如何确保HTML5应用在不同硬件配置下的性能一致性,以及如何实现与本地应用的无缝交互,都是当前需要解决的问题。

2. HTML5能否替代传统的本地应用?

随着HTML5技术的不断发展,一个重要的问题是:HTML5能否替代传统的本地应用?这一问题涉及到用户体验、性能、安全性等多个方面。

用户体验

HTML5应用的一个显著优势是其跨平台特性,用户无需安装任何软件即可通过浏览器访问应用。然而,这也带来了一些用户体验上的挑战。例如,HTML5应用的响应速度可能不如本地应用,尤其是在处理复杂任务时。

性能

性能是决定HTML5能否替代本地应用的关键因素之一。尽管HTML5在图形渲染、音频处理等方面已经有了显著提升,但在处理大规模数据、复杂计算任务时,其性能仍然不如本地应用。

安全性

安全性是另一个需要考虑的重要因素。HTML5应用运行在浏览器中,这意味着它们更容易受到网络攻击。尽管现代浏览器已经内置了多种安全机制,但与本地应用相比,HTML5应用的安全性仍然存在一定的风险。

3. HTML5在笔记本操作系统中的未来发展趋势是什么?

展望未来,HTML5在笔记本操作系统中的应用将如何发展?哪些新技术和新趋势将推动这一领域的发展?

新技术

随着WebAssembly等新技术的出现,HTML5的性能得到了进一步提升。WebAssembly是一种可以在现代浏览器中运行的低级字节码,它允许开发者使用C、C++等语言编写高性能的Web应用。这一技术的引入,使得HTML5应用在处理复杂任务时,性能接近甚至超越本地应用。

新趋势

另一个值得关注的新趋势是PWA(Progressive Web App)的兴起。PWA是一种结合了Web应用和本地应用优点的应用形式,它可以在离线状态下运行,并且可以像本地应用一样安装在设备上。这一趋势将进一步推动HTML5在笔记本操作系统中的应用。

4. 如何优化HTML5应用在笔记本操作系统中的性能?

为了充分发挥HTML5在笔记本操作系统中的潜力,如何优化其性能是一个关键问题。以下是一些可能的优化策略:

代码优化

优化HTML5应用的代码是提升性能的基础。开发者可以通过减少DOM操作、使用CSS3动画替代JavaScript动画等方式,提升应用的响应速度。

资源管理

合理管理应用的资源,如图片、音频、视频等,也是提升性能的重要手段。开发者可以通过压缩资源、使用懒加载等方式,减少应用的加载时间。

硬件加速

利用现代浏览器的硬件加速功能,可以进一步提升HTML5应用的性能。例如,使用WebGL进行图形渲染,可以充分利用GPU的计算能力,提升应用的渲染速度。

结论

HTML5作为一种强大的网页开发技术,正在逐渐渗透到笔记本操作系统中。尽管其在应用现状、替代本地应用的可能性、未来发展趋势以及性能优化等方面仍然面临一些挑战,但随着新技术的不断涌现,HTML5在笔记本操作系统中的应用前景依然广阔。通过深入探讨这些问题,我们可以更好地理解HTML5在笔记本操作系统中的潜力,并为未来的技术发展提供有价值的参考。